Claude Code SDK for C#

A .NET SDK for interacting with Claude through the Claude Code CLI, providing both one-shot queries and interactive client sessions with full Microsoft Agent Framework (MAF) integration.

Status & Version

NuGet Version (with prereleases) NuGet Version (with prereleases) CI/CD

Package versions use the format x.y.z and may include a -preview suffix for prerelease builds.

  • x follows the target .NET version.
  • y is incremented when the library introduces breaking changes or updates its Microsoft Agent Framework dependency.
  • z is incremented for library patch releases.

Features

  • One-shot Queries - Simple request/response pattern via ClaudeQuery.QueryAsync
  • Interactive Client - Bidirectional communication with ClaudeSdkClient
  • Streaming Support - Real-time response streaming via IAsyncEnumerable<T>
  • Partial Messages - Optional token-level text, thinking, and Tool Call streaming
  • Microsoft Agent Framework Integration - Use Claude as an AIAgent (ClaudeCodeSdk.MAF)
  • Session Management - Multi-turn conversations with session support and automatic session lifecycle management
  • Session Persistence - Serialize/deserialize conversation sessions for storage
  • Tool Integration - Full support for Claude Code tools and MCP servers
  • Human Input Callbacks - Handle permissions and AskUserQuestion through the stdio control protocol
  • Thinking Blocks - Extended reasoning with configurable thinking tokens
  • Usage Tracking - Token usage and cost monitoring
  • .NET 10.0 - Targets net10.0
  • Modern Async/Await - Full IAsyncDisposable support with proper resource management

Installation

Core SDK

Install via NuGet:

dotnet add package ClaudeCodeSdk

Microsoft Agent Framework Integration (Optional)

For Microsoft Agent Framework support:

dotnet add package ClaudeCodeSdk.MAF

Prerequisites

  • .NET 10.0 SDK
  • Claude Code CLI available on PATH. For example, install it via npm:
    npm install -g @anthropic-ai/claude-code
  • API Key: Set ANTHROPIC_AUTH_TOKEN environment variable with your Anthropic API key

Quick Start

One-shot Query

using ClaudeCodeSdk;
using ClaudeCodeSdk.Types;

await foreach (var message in ClaudeQuery.QueryAsync("What is the capital of France?"))
{
    if (message is AssistantMessage assistantMessage)
    {
        foreach (var text in assistantMessage.Content.OfType<TextBlock>())
        {
            Console.WriteLine(text.Text);
        }
    }
}

Interactive Client

using ClaudeCodeSdk;
using ClaudeCodeSdk.Types;

await using var client = new ClaudeSdkClient();
await client.ConnectAsync();

await client.QueryAsync("Hello Claude!");

await foreach (var message in client.ReceiveResponseAsync())
{
    if (message is AssistantMessage assistantMsg)
    {
        foreach (var text in assistantMsg.Content.OfType<TextBlock>())
        {
            Console.WriteLine($"Claude: {text.Text}");
        }
    }
}

Microsoft Agent Framework Integration

using ClaudeCodeSdk.MAF;
using Microsoft.Extensions.AI;

// Create Claude as an AIAgent
await using var agent = new ClaudeCodeAIAgent();

// Simple query
var response = await agent.RunAsync("Explain async/await in C#");
Console.WriteLine(response.Text);

// Multi-turn conversation with session
var session = await agent.CreateSessionAsync();
var response1 = await agent.RunAsync(
    [new ChatMessage(ChatRole.User, "What is dependency injection?")],
    session: session
);

// Context is automatically preserved across turns
var response2 = await agent.RunAsync(
    [new ChatMessage(ChatRole.User, "Show me an example in C#")],
    session: session
);

// Streaming with real-time updates
await foreach (var update in agent.RunStreamingAsync("Tell me a story", session: session))
{
    if (update.Contents != null)
    {
        foreach (var content in update.Contents)
        {
            if (content is TextContent text)
            {
                Console.Write(text.Text);
            }
        }
    }
}

See ClaudeCodeSdk.MAF README for complete MAF integration documentation.

Important

MAF forwards text and image DataContent from the first user message. If you need a global instruction, configure ClaudeCodeAIAgentOptions.SystemPrompt (or AppendSystemPrompt) instead of relying on per-request ChatRole.System messages.

Tip

For long-running conversations backed by your own storage, configure ClaudeCodeAIAgentOptions.ChatHistoryProvider to observe each request and save new messages after each response. Claude Code resumes model history through the supplied AgentSession ID rather than resending stored messages as prompt input.

Architecture

The SDK implements a simplified dual-pattern architecture for Claude Code interactions:

Core Components

ClaudeProcess - Unified subprocess manager

  • Direct subprocess communication with Claude Code CLI
  • JSON-based message protocol with strongly-typed parsing
  • Automatic CLI discovery and process lifecycle management
  • Shared by both ClaudeQuery and ClaudeSdkClient

ClaudeQuery - One-shot query API

  • Fire-and-forget pattern for simple queries
  • Streams responses as IAsyncEnumerable<IMessage>
  • Automatically handles connection lifecycle
  • Ideal for single-request scenarios

ClaudeSdkClient - Interactive client API

  • Long-lived bidirectional communication
  • Manual connection control via ConnectAsync/DisconnectAsync
  • Session management with multi-turn conversations
  • Interrupt support and resource cleanup

Message Types

All messages implement IMessage:

  • AssistantMessage - Claude's responses with content blocks
  • UserMessage - User input
  • SystemMessage - System notifications and metadata
  • ResultMessage - End-of-conversation marker with cost/usage data
  • StreamEvent - Raw partial-message event emitted when IncludePartialMessages is enabled

Content Blocks

All content blocks implement IContentBlock:

  • TextBlock - Plain text content
  • ThinkingBlock - Claude's reasoning (when extended thinking is enabled)
  • ToolUseBlock - Tool invocations
  • ToolResultBlock - Tool execution results
  • ErrorContentBlock - Error information

Exception Hierarchy

Custom exceptions inherit from ClaudeSDKException:

  • CLINotFoundException - Claude Code CLI not found
  • CLIConnectionException - Transport connection issues
  • ProcessException - Subprocess execution failures
  • CLIJsonDecodeException - Message parsing errors
  • MessageParseException - Type conversion failures

Microsoft Agent Framework Integration

The MAF integration (ClaudeCodeSdk.MAF) provides:

ClaudeCodeAIAgent

  • Full AIAgent implementation from Microsoft.Agents.AI
  • Streaming and non-streaming execution modes
  • Session-based conversation management
  • Automatic session persistence via ClaudeSdkClientManager
  • System prompt extraction and configuration

ClaudeCodeAgentSession

  • Session serialization/deserialization for persistence
  • Session ID management for conversation continuity
  • Compatible with MAF's AIConversationState

ClaudeSdkClientManager

  • Automatic client lifecycle management
  • Disposes old clients when switching sessions
  • Session-safe with proper async resource management
  • Optimizes resource usage across multiple sessions

Configuration

Environment Variables

The SDK automatically configures these environment variables for the Claude Code CLI:

  • ANTHROPIC_AUTH_TOKEN - API authentication (from ClaudeCodeOptions.ApiKey or environment)
  • ANTHROPIC_BASE_URL - Custom API endpoint (from ClaudeCodeOptions.BaseUrl)
  • CLAUDE_CODE_ENTRYPOINT - SDK identifier (always "sdk-csharp")

ClaudeCodeOptions

Key configuration options:

var options = new ClaudeCodeOptions
{
    ApiKey = "sk-ant-...",              // Anthropic API key
    BaseUrl = "https://api.anthropic.com", // Custom API endpoint
    MaxThinkingTokens = 10000,          // Extended thinking budget
    SystemPrompt = "You are a helpful assistant",
    Model = "sonnet",                   // Stable alias for the latest Sonnet model
    IncludePartialMessages = true,       // Emit raw StreamEvent messages
    PermissionMode = PermissionMode.acceptEdits, // Tool approval mode
    WorkingDirectory = "/path/to/project",
    MaxTurns = 10,
    EnvironmentVariables = new Dictionary<string, string?>
    {
        { "HTTP_PROXY", "http://proxy:1080" }
    }
};

Streaming partial messages

Set IncludePartialMessages to receive raw Claude Code StreamEvent messages before each complete AssistantMessage. Each event preserves the CLI's original JSON payload so callers can handle new event types without waiting for an SDK update.

ClaudeCodeSdk.MAF translates supported partial events into standard AgentResponseUpdate chunks. Text and thinking deltas are emitted immediately with a stable ResponseId and MessageId; Tool Use JSON is accumulated internally and emitted as a complete FunctionCallContent when its content block ends. The later complete AssistantMessage is used only as a fallback for content that was not already streamed.

When a MAF ChatHistoryProvider is configured together with partial messages, deltas are emitted as they arrive. Each logical Assistant message is persisted after both its message_stop event and complete AssistantMessage arrive, before the corresponding processed message is yielded. The SDK combines that message's updates with ToAgentResponse(), so a run containing multiple Tool Use rounds can persist multiple completed history batches. Tool results are carried into the next completed Assistant batch. On normal completion, failure, cancellation, source exception, or early consumer disposal, the SDK also persists any remaining buffered updates in their original order, including incomplete Assistant text and tool fragments. Final persistence ignores the run cancellation token; if both the stream and persistence fail, the stream failure remains primary. Without partial events, the SDK retains the compatible end-of-run aggregation fallback.

Handling tool permissions and questions

Set CanUseTool to handle Claude Code permission requests without a terminal. The SDK automatically configures --permission-prompt-tool stdio; the callback can remain pending while your application collects user input.

var options = new ClaudeCodeOptions
{
    CanUseTool = async (toolName, input, context, cancellationToken) =>
    {
        if (toolName != "AskUserQuestion")
        {
            return new PermissionResultDeny($"Unsupported request: {toolName}");
        }

        var updatedInput = await CollectAnswersAsync(input, cancellationToken);
        return new PermissionResultAllow(updatedInput);
    }
};

PermissionResultAllow preserves the original input when UpdatedInput is omitted. For AskUserQuestion, return the original questions plus an answers object. Cancelling the query also cancels the pending callback.

Development

Building

# Build the entire solution
dotnet build

# Build specific project
dotnet build src/ClaudeCodeSdk/ClaudeCodeSdk.csproj

Testing

# Run all tests
dotnet test

# Run with verbose output
dotnet test --verbosity normal

# Run specific test
dotnet test --filter "FullyQualifiedName~ExceptionsTests"

Running Examples

# Run all examples
dotnet run --project examples/ClaudeCodeSdk.Examples.csproj

# Run specific example class
dotnet run --project examples/ClaudeCodeSdk.Examples.csproj -- --example QuickStart

Packaging NuGet Packages

# Pack both SDK and MAF packages
dotnet pack src/ClaudeCodeSdk/ClaudeCodeSdk.csproj -c Release
dotnet pack src/ClaudeCodeSdk.MAF/ClaudeCodeSdk.MAF.csproj -c Release

# Pack with symbols
dotnet pack src/ClaudeCodeSdk/ClaudeCodeSdk.csproj -c Release -p:IncludeSymbols=true

Key Behaviors

Message Streaming and Termination

  • ClaudeProcess.ReceiveAsync() automatically terminates when receiving a ResultMessage
  • Both ClaudeQuery and ClaudeSdkClient rely on this automatic termination
  • ClaudeSdkClient.ReceiveResponseAsync() provides convenience method that yields until ResultMessage

JSON Serialization

  • Uses snake_case_lower naming policy via JsonUtil for Claude Code CLI compatibility
  • Consistent serialization across all message exchanges

Resource Management

  • All process-managing classes implement IAsyncDisposable
  • ClaudeProcess handles subprocess lifecycle (start, kill, cleanup)
  • Use await using for automatic cleanup

MAF Session Management

  • ClaudeSdkClientManager automatically handles client creation/disposal when switching sessions
  • Agent session IDs are sent as session_id on user messages for conversation continuity
  • Session state persists via the session's SessionId

Troubleshooting

"Claude Code CLI not found"

Ensure Claude Code CLI is installed globally:

npm install -g @anthropic-ai/claude-code

Authentication Errors

Set your API key:

# macOS/Linux
export ANTHROPIC_AUTH_TOKEN="your-api-key"

# Windows PowerShell
$env:ANTHROPIC_AUTH_TOKEN="your-api-key"

# Windows Command Prompt
set ANTHROPIC_AUTH_TOKEN=your-api-key

Or pass it via options:

var options = new ClaudeCodeOptions { ApiKey = "your-api-key" };

Process Lifecycle Issues

Always dispose of SDK objects properly:

await using var client = new ClaudeSdkClient();
await client.ConnectAsync();
// ... use client
// Automatic disposal on scope exit
